The ratio between the surface area of sphere and hemisphere is ………… A) 3 : 1 B) 1 : 3 C) 4 : 3 D) 3 : 4 |
Answer» Correct option is: C) 4 : 3 Surface area of sphere = \(4 \pi r^2\) Surface area of hemisphere = \(3\pi r^2\) \(\therefore\) \(\frac {Surface \, area \, of\, sphere}{surface \, area \, of \, hemisphere}\) = \(\frac {4 \pi r^2}{3 \pi r^2} = \frac 43 = 4: 3\) Hence, the ratio between the surface area of sphere and hemisphere is 4 : 3.
